C5ISR Market size was valued at US$ 136.83 Million in 2024, expanding at a CAGR of 2.98% from 2025 to 2032.
C5ISR stands for Command, Control, Computers, Communications, Cyber, Intelligence, Surveillance, and Reconnaissance. For effective Command and Control, military personnel require equipment that facilitates comprehensive situational awareness. This necessitates that commanders and their teams have dependable and secure access to communication channels and any intelligence that could support their objectives. The C5ISR sector is vital for defense and security, supplying essential tools that enable military forces to function effectively and address threats across diverse operational settings. It incorporates advanced technologies such as artificial intelligence, machine learning, and autonomous systems to improve operational efficiency, enhance decision-making, and increase awareness on the battlefield.
C5ISR Market- Market Dynamics
The expansion of Defense Modernization Programs is expected to significantly contribute to market growth. As nations increasingly prioritize the modernization of their military capabilities to counter emerging threats and improve operational efficiency, there is a heightened demand for sophisticated C5ISR systems. According to the Congressional Budget Office (CBO), the United States is projected to allocate approximately USD 756 billion towards the modernization of the Department of Defense (DoD) and Department of Energy (DOE) nuclear weapons programs from fiscal years 2023 to 2032. This equates to an annual expenditure of around USD 75 billion on nuclear weapons, which is comparable to funding more than two Manhattan projects each year over the next eight years. Additionally, the rising deployment of unmanned aerial vehicles (UAVs), unmanned ground vehicles (UGVs), and autonomous maritime systems in defense operations presents a significant opportunity for C5ISR systems. Nevertheless, the presence of cybersecurity risks may pose challenges to market growth.

C5ISR Market- Geographical Insights
North America leads the market primarily due to its commitment to modernizing existing defense surveillance, control, and command systems. The region, with the United States at the forefront, possesses one of the largest defense budgets globally, facilitating considerable investment in advanced C5ISR systems. This financial support is directed toward the enhancement of surveillance, communication, and command systems, thereby bolstering national security and military effectiveness. In 2023, the US military allocated approximately USD 820.3 billion, accounting for about 13.3% of the total federal budget for that fiscal year. Furthermore, in March 2023, the Department of Defense (DoD) submitted a request for USD 842.0 billion for the fiscal year 2024, reflecting a 2.6% increase. Meanwhile, Europe is experiencing rapid growth due to its modernization initiatives and military partnerships, while the Asia-Pacific region, particularly China and India, is making significant investments in C5ISR systems in response to regional security challenges.

General Dynamics Information Technology (GDIT), a division of General Dynamics, announced on January 31, 2022, that it has been awarded a task order valued at USD 518 million by the U.S. Army Communications Electronics Command (CECOM). This award is designated for the provision of logistics, sustainment, and maintenance services to support joint U.S. and coalition forces globally within the Army Field Support Brigade (AFSB) regions.
PT Len Industri and Thales have entered into a strategic partnership agreement aimed at enhancing collaboration across various defense-related areas, which encompass radars, military satellites, electronic warfare, unmanned aerial vehicles (UAVs), and combat management systems.
